titleOfInvention Rubber composition and tires
abstract Rubber component, and the following general formula (1): [Wherein, X 1 and X 2 represent a heterocyclic group which may have a substituent.] A rubber composition containing a tetrazine compound or a salt thereof, and a processing aid, wherein the rubber composition contains 40 parts by mass or more of a diene rubber polymerized with a monomer containing a 1,3-butadiene monomer in 100 parts by mass of the rubber component. , The rubber composition containing 0.1-10 mass parts of said tetraazine compounds or its salt with respect to 100 mass parts of rubber components.
